Aspects Influencing Shipping Container Costs
The cost of shipping containers can differ significantly based on numerous elements. Comprehending these aspects can help you prepare for expenses and make better-budgeted decisions. Here are the primary elements that influence shipping container pricing:
1. Container Type
Shipping containers come in various types, each designed for particular uses. The most typical types include:
Standard Dry Containers: These are the most regularly used containers for basic cargo.Reefer Containers: Temperature-controlled containers ideal for shipping disposable goods.Open Top Containers: Perfect for oversized cargo that can not fit through conventional container doors.Flat Rack Containers ([md.un-hack-bar.de](https://md.un-hack-bar.de/s/KPuWQYNQua)): Utilized for heavy or awkwardly shaped products.High Cube Containers: Similar to standard containers but with an additional foot in height.
Table 1: Average Prices of Different Container Types
Container TypeTypical Cost (GBP)Standard Dry Container₤ 2,000 - ₤ 4,500Reefer Container₤ 3,000 - ₤ 7,000Open Top Container₤ 2,500 - ₤ 5,000Flat Rack Container₤ 2,000 - ₤ 4,000High Cube Container₤ 2,500 - ₤ 5,5002. Condition of the Container
The condition plays a significant function in determining the cost:
New Containers: These containers come at a premium price however offer the best resilience and visual appeal.Used Containers: More budget-friendly alternatives that might reveal wear and tear however are still functional.Refurbished Containers: These go through repairs and upgrades, using a middle-ground pricing alternative.
Table 2: Cost Comparison Based on Container Condition
ConditionTypical Cost (GBP)New₤ 4,000 - ₤ 6,000Used₤ 2,000 - ₤ 3,500Reconditioned₤ 3,000 - ₤ 5,0003. Size of the Container
Shipping containers are readily available in numerous sizes, normally measured in TEUs (Twenty-foot Equivalent Units). The 2 most common sizes are 20-foot and 40-foot containers, affecting cost considerably.

Table 3: Cost Based on Container Size
Container SizeAverage Cost (GBP)20-foot₤ 2,000 - ₤ 4,00040-foot₤ 3,500 - ₤ 5,5004. Location and Delivery
The geographical area can affect container costs due to transport fees. Urban locations might have greater prices due to demand, while rural areas might have lower costs however higher delivery charges.

Cost Breakdown Examples
When considering the purchase of shipping containers, it is important to think about the total cost, that includes not only the rate of the container but likewise additional costs like:
Delivery charges: Depending on the range from the supplier.Customizeds tasks and taxes: If importing [Freight Containers](https://oakmontforum.com/members/layerseat98/activity/153349/) from another country.Modification expenses: If the container needs alterations for particular applications.
Table 4: Total Cost Estimation for Container Purchase
Container TypeBase Cost (GBP)Delivery (GBP)Modification (GBP)Total Cost (GBP)20-foot Dry Container₤ 2,500₤ 400₤ 300₤ 3,20040-foot Reefer Container₤ 6,000₤ 600₤ 500₤ 7,100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: What is the typical lifespan of a shipping container?
A1: The average life expectancy of a shipping container is around 10 to 15 years, depending upon its use and maintenance.
Q2: Can I rent a shipping container instead of buying?
A2: Yes, lots of business offer rental services for shipping containers, permitting you to pay a month-to-month charge instead of a swelling sum.
Q3: Are there additional expenses related to owning a shipping container?
A3: Yes, upkeep, insurance, and storage charges might be sustained after purchase.
Q4: How should I prepare my area for a shipping container?
A4: Ensure the location is level, accessible, and has adequate drain to avoid wetness accumulation.
Q5: Is it possible to modify a shipping container?
A5: Absolutely, shipping containers can be modified for various usages, consisting of homes, workplaces, and even pool, with adjustments for doors, windows, and insulation.
